LEED Silver Renovation of the Schmitthenner Building
This LEED Silver project completely renovated a 4900 sq. ft. historic structure built in 1900 that had been vacant for at least 30 years. It is a prominent corner building at 1527 Elm street, just south of Liberty. The City of Cincinnati listed this structure as one of its top “at risk” historic buildings. In […]

Sustainable Building for Mackey Advisors
It was the intent of Mackey Advisors, to not only restore the building to its original historic façade, but create a sustainable building with emphasis on natural light, fresh air, and green space.
